赞
踩
今天由于conda安装过程太慢了,然后我意识到要用镜像来安装接下来的包会更快一点,于是在网上找了一个pytorch的安装教程Mac上PyTorch安装教程(基于Anaconda) - 知乎 (zhihu.com),根据上面的镜像进行了添加,添加完之后,我没有根据文中说的把channels
里面的-defaults
删掉,然后执行了命令
conda install pytorch torchvision
但是感觉删不删是不影响的,只不过是快慢问题,然后安装完成,过程也没有报错,然后我就在conda(base)环境中进行了验证,输入`python`,然后输入`import torch`,然后就出现了
```
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
ModuleNotFoundError: No module named 'torch'
```
然后我寻思按照文章里说的创建一个虚拟conda环境看看,但是还是不行
pip3
来安装torch、重新激活虚拟环境,都不行最后知道真相的我眼泪掉下来,原来我没有踩坑,只是python3以上的版本需要用命令python3
,而我一直用的是python
好傻逼啊救命,如果用python
命令的话就会进入mac默认的python版本,而conda
每个虚拟环境里面可能torch
对应的python
版本都是不一样的,所以每次才会torch
和python
版本对不上号,可喜的是我还知道只因为版本号对不上,想方设法想改版本号,最后是命令就输错了,流下了两行独立的泪水!!!
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。